Benefits of Laser Dentistry

Posted by DR. CHRISTINE Y. LEE on Jun 28 2022, 07:04 AM

Modernizing world and advanced technology have made our life much more comfortable than the traditional lifestyle. In the same way, it has brought lots of advancements in the field of dentistry. Laser dentistry is a modern method of dental treatment that offers many benefits to patients. Laser dentistry is safe, effective, and more comfortable than traditional dental treatment methods.

Advantages of Laser Dentistry

Quicker appointments

Laser dentistry uses beams of light energy for procedures, eliminating the need to use anesthesia in many cases. As a result, there is less bleeding, less pain, and shorter healing times. Laser dentistry can also effectively treat cavities without the need for drills or needles.

Less pain

Laser dentistry is more comfortable than many other dental techniques. You may require numbing injections and even sedation, but laser dentistry is virtually painless. Laser dentistry also decreases your chances of infection, bleeding, and swelling. Lasers can also treat soft tissues, such as gums and reshape your enamel into the ideal shape.

Fewer shots

The drill is only one of many tools used to perform dental work. With laser dentistry, the need for drilling is drastically reduced. Periodontal treatments, for instance, are completed with laser technology. Laser dentistry also comes with the added benefit of no shots.

Minimally invasive

Laser dentistry is a comfortable, minimally-invasive way to improve your smile. The laser beam is very precise, so your dentist can pinpoint and work on just one tooth at a time. Laser dentistry is extremely versatile and can be used to help eliminate tooth decay, mild gum disease, and even reshape and recontour gums.

No need for anesthesia

Laser dentistry is revolutionary because it accomplishes things never before possible with dental technology. Patients don’t need to worry about feeling any pain during dental procedures. The laser is able to remove gum tissue and penetrate deep into the tooth structure. It’s even able to remove decay from tooth structure.

Less bleeding and swelling

Some patients experience less bleeding and swelling after laser dentistry procedures. In addition, lasers often eliminate the need for incisions, sutures, and needles, so patients are less likely to experience pain or discomfort.

Quicker recovery time

Laser dentistry allows for quicker recovery times compared to traditional dentistry. The minimally invasive laser dentistry procedures don’t involve cutting, which means your gums won’t bleed, and you won’t need stitches. Patients also won’t experience any lingering numbness in the treatment area.

Better precision

When compared to traditional treatment methods, laser dentistry offers better precision. Dental lasers can cut through tooth enamel, gum tissue, and bone with a level of accuracy that’s tough to beat. When we use lasers to perform a variety of treatments, we’re often able to preserve more of the healthy tissue surrounding the affected area.
